Population Milestones
Key historical points in human population growth.
Total Fertility Rate (TFR)
Rate of births needed for population replacement.
Carrying Capacity
Maximum population size an environment can sustain.
Contraception
Methods to prevent pregnancy and control birth rates.
Demographic Transition
Model showing population changes over time.
Cairo Consensus
Agreement emphasizing gender equality in population management.
Ecological Footprint
Land and water area required for resource consumption.
I = PAT Formula
Impact equals population times affluence times technology.
Water Reservoirs
Natural storage locations for Earth's water supply.
Residence Time
Average duration water remains in a reservoir.
Groundwater-dependent Ecosystems
Ecosystems reliant on groundwater for survival.
Point Source Pollution
Pollution from identifiable sources like pipes.
Nonpoint Source Pollution
Diffuse pollution from sources like agricultural runoff.
Water Scarcity
Insufficient freshwater availability for population needs.
Carbon Capture and Storage (CCS)
Technology to capture and store CO₂ emissions.
Renewable Energy
Energy from sources that replenish naturally.
Paris Agreement
International treaty to limit global temperature rise.
Sustainable Resource Management
Practices ensuring resources are used responsibly.
Recycling
Process of converting waste into reusable materials.
Electronic Waste (E-waste)
Discarded electronic devices containing hazardous materials.
Green Technology
Innovative solutions reducing environmental impact.
Urban Sustainability
City initiatives for pollution reduction and green spaces.
Pollution Taxes
Financial charges to reduce environmental pollution.
Local Sustainability Programs
Community efforts promoting conservation and recycling.
Groundwater Depletion
Over-extraction of groundwater leading to resource issues.
Overfishing
Catching fish faster than they can reproduce.
Desalination
Process of removing salt from seawater for freshwater.
Stability Transition
Phase where birth and death rates stabilize.
